1. Consider the reaction: Cr2O72- (aq) + 14 H+ (aq) + 6 Fe2+ (aq) >>> 2 Cr3+ (aq) + 6 Fe3+ (aq) + 7 H2O (l)

In the lab, it is found that 19.30 mL of K2Cr2O7 solution is needed to react with 25.00 mL of 0.4000 M Fe2+ (aq) solution, what is the molarity of the potassium dichromate solution?
